Child care providers, advocates respond to state voucher cuts

Indiana child care workers and advocates are condemning the new cuts to the Child Care and Development Fund reimbursement rates.

The CCDF is a state-administered federal program that provides financial support to low-income families for child care so parents can work, go to school or attend training.
